What is the TCF exam, and who should take it?

The TCF (Test de Connaissance du Français) is an official French language proficiency test created by France’s Ministry of Education. It is designed to assess non-native speakers’ general French abilities, covering listening, reading, writing, and speaking. The TCF follows the CEFR (Common European Framework of Reference for Languages), ranging from A1 (beginner) to C2 (advanced) levels.

The TCF is ideal for people who need to demonstrate their French skills for specific purposes. It is often required for university admissions in French-speaking institutions, job applications, and visa or residency applications, including the TCF Canada and TCF ANF (for French nationality). Anyone aiming to prove their French language competence for academic, professional, or immigration purposes should consider taking the TCF.

How long should I study for the TCF exam?

The amount of time needed to study for the TCF exam depends on your current level of French and the score you aim to achieve. For beginners (A1-A2), 2-3 months of consistent study may be sufficient to prepare for the test. If you’re at an intermediate level (B1-B2), it may take 3-6 months to build the skills necessary to perform well, especially in the speaking and writing sections. Advanced learners (C1-C2) may need 6 months or more of focused study to refine their skills and ensure they are fully prepared.

To make the most of your preparation time, it’s important to regularly practice each section of the exam – listening, reading, writing, and speaking – and work with a tutor who can guide you through the test format and help you improve in specific areas. Consistency and targeted practice will increase your chances of success.
